Horizontal/Video Plotter display

The horizontal display appears in the main window; the video plotter display, which mainly
traces ship’s track, in the sub window. Compared to the horizontal display the video
plotter’s range is much longer. For example, an event marker entered on the horizontal
display disappears from that display when it goes out of the current range. However, it
remains on the video plotter display for a much longer time when a long range scale is
used. This can be useful when you want to return to the location marked with an event
marker. To show track on the horizontal display the tilt angle must be less than 75
degrees.

You may switch control between the horizontal display and the video plotter display with
the [MAIN/SUB] key. The message MAIN WINDOW CONTROLLABLE or SUB WINDOW
CONTROLLABLE appears with each pressing of the key. A red rectangle circumscribes
the sub window when it is selected. With the video plotter display selected you may
change its range with the [RANGE] control.

Note: Controls other than RANGE may only be operated from the main window. When

you attempt to operate them when the sub window is selected the message
SELECT MAIN WINDOW appears.
